4 changes: 4 additions & 0 deletions core/src/main/java/io/grpc/internal/RetriableStream.java
Expand Up @@ -550,6 +550,10 @@ class SendMessageEntry implements BufferEntry {
@Override
public void runWith(Substream substream) {
substream.stream.writeMessage(method.streamRequest(message));
// TODO(ejona): Workaround Netty memory leak. Message writes always need to be followed by
// flushes (or half close), but retry appears to have a code path that the flushes may
// not happen. The code needs to be fixed and this removed. See #9340.
substream.stream.flush();
}
}
